ThirdLove

One of the first people you may wish to acquaint yourself with could be David Spector of ThirdLove. This company was first founded in 2013. Alongside his wife, Spector creates lingerie that women love. ThirdLove is a company that puts women at the forefront of its operations. This may be, in part, why Spector stays in the shadows regarding the marketing for ThirdLove. Instead, he lets the female members of the team take center stage. In a world where men can still often be given more benefits than women, it is refreshing to find a CEO who wants to balance the scales that bit more.

Natori

Next, you may want to think about the 1977 company Natori. This one may be a little older than ThirdLove, but the team also has a number of reasons to be proud of their achievements. Natori’s founder is Filipino Josie Natori, who moved to New York when she was only 17 years old. Alongside creating lingerie, Natori works hard to be a charitable company. Both the company and the creator herself give to a number of ventures. While some of these may benefit the United States, others help to improve life back in the Philippines. It is clear that, while successful now, Natori hasn’t forgotten her Filipino roots. She may even use them to motivate her within her work.
